      <description>&lt;P&gt;i have recently deployed a site to site between a Firepower FTD and a ASA which is up and working but im unable to monitor the FTD using SNMP over the VPN. i have enabled access via the platform settings however it seems im only able to get stats if i use the external IP address of the firewall. This is not an option as it would be sending all SNMP traffic over the internet and not down the tunnel. I know in the traditional ASA config you would apply the management-access command which would make inbound VPN connections terminate on an interface of your choosing. I thought about trying to apply a flex config with the management-access statement but im unsure if this would work.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;has anyone else been able to deploy SNMP successfully to an FTD without using the FMC or the outside VPN address?&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>Hi,&lt;BR /&gt;I seem to recall having to use the "management-access" command with Flexconfig in a previous deployment, this worked ok. FYI, I also remember it would not work if you were using a BVI on the inside.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;HTH</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;I'd like to second that statement. I have my monitoring centralized watching sites over VPN and adding &lt;EM&gt;management-access&amp;nbsp;&lt;/EM&gt;using FlexConfig allowed me to monitor the FTDs on one of the data interfaces behind the VPNs.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Regards&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Fredrik&lt;/P&gt;</description>
